Introduction

The bull shark (Carcharhinus leucas) is a stocky, broad-snouted shark famous for venturing farther up rivers than almost any other shark species. Found in warm, shallow seas along coasts and far into freshwater systems on every continent except Antarctica, it is one of the few sharks that tolerates both salt and fresh water. Its adaptability, aggression, and proximity to human swimmers have made it one of the most discussed large sharks in the world. Its blunt profile and muscular build give it a bulky look that separates it at a glance from the sleeker open-ocean sharks.

Physical Characteristics

An adult bull shark typically reaches 2.1 to 3.4 meters and weighs 90 to 230 kilograms, with females larger than males. The body is robust rather than streamlined, the snout short and blunt, and the pectoral fins broad. Coloration is grey above fading to a white belly, a pattern that hides the shark from prey above and below. The jaws hold row upon row of triangular, serrated teeth built for shearing rather than gripping. A row of tiny sensory pores behind the head helps the shark detect the faint electric fields of hidden prey.

Habitat

Bull sharks prefer depths of less than 30 meters in bays, estuaries, and river mouths, but they have been recorded more than 3,000 kilometers up the Amazon and as far as 1,100 kilometers up Australia’s Brisbane River. They use turbid, low-visibility water as hunting cover and pupping nursery. This fondness for murky shallows brings it into frequent contact with people. Seasonal flooding can even carry bull sharks into flooded forests, where they hunt among the submerged treetops.

Diet

A bull shark is an unfussy, powerful predator. It eats bony fishes, rays, smaller sharks, sea turtles, dolphins, and crustaceans, and will scavenge when the chance arises. Young bulls in rivers feed heavily on freshwater catfish and turtles. Their wide mouths and crushing bite let them take prey nearly as large as themselves, and they often hunt in packs that drive schools of fish into tight, easy meals. They will also scavenge carrion and discarded offal from boats when the chance arises.

Reproduction

Bull sharks are live-bearing: the female carries her young internally and gives birth to 1 to 13 free-swimming pups after a gestation of about 10 to 11 months. Births happen in sheltered estuaries and river mouths where predators are fewer and food is rich. The pups are independent from birth and grow quickly, though many fall prey to larger sharks and crocodiles in those nursery waters. Mothers return to the same estuaries year after year, a loyalty that makes those habitats critical to local populations.

Conservation

Globally the bull shark is listed as Near Threatened, pressured by commercial and recreational fishing, bycatch, and the loss of coastal nursery habitat. It is also hunted for its fins and meat in some regions. Because it ranges so widely and breeds slowly, local declines can be hard to reverse, and several countries now protect key pupping estuaries. Citizen-science sightings have helped map bull shark movements in several river systems, aiding those protection plans.
